数据库pck文件是什么
-
数据库pck文件是一种常见的数据库文件格式,用于将数据库的数据和结构以二进制形式进行存储和传输。下面是关于数据库pck文件的一些重要信息:
-
文件结构:数据库pck文件通常由多个数据块组成,每个数据块都包含了特定的数据和结构信息。这些数据块可以包含表、索引、约束、触发器等数据库对象的定义和数据。文件中的数据块可以通过索引或链表等方式进行组织和访问。
-
数据存储:数据库pck文件中的数据以二进制形式进行存储,这样可以提高数据的读取和写入速度。数据被分成多个页,每个页的大小可以根据具体需求进行设置。数据库引擎可以通过直接访问这些页来读取和写入数据,而无需解析和转换数据格式。
-
数据压缩:为了减小文件的大小和提高数据传输效率,数据库pck文件通常会对数据进行压缩。常见的压缩算法包括LZ77、LZ78、LZSS等。压缩后的数据可以通过解压算法还原成原始数据。
-
数据加密:为了保护敏感数据的安全性,数据库pck文件通常会对数据进行加密。加密可以使用对称加密算法(如AES、DES)或非对称加密算法(如RSA、ECC)。加密后的数据只能通过相应的密钥进行解密。
-
数据一致性:数据库pck文件通常使用事务来保证数据的一致性。事务是一组数据库操作的逻辑单元,要么全部执行成功,要么全部回滚。数据库引擎可以通过记录事务日志来实现事务的持久性和恢复功能,以确保数据的完整性和可靠性。
总结:数据库pck文件是一种用于存储和传输数据库数据和结构的文件格式。它通过二进制存储、数据压缩、数据加密和事务等技术实现了高效的数据管理和安全性保护。了解数据库pck文件的结构和特点对于数据库的设计和维护非常重要。
1年前 -
-
数据库pck文件是一种数据库文件的格式,用于存储和管理数据库中的数据。pck文件通常是一种二进制文件,它包含了数据库的表结构、数据记录、索引以及其他相关信息。
在数据库中,数据通常以表的形式进行组织和存储。每个表由一系列的列组成,每列定义了数据的类型和约束条件。表中的数据记录以行的形式存储,每行对应一个数据记录。而pck文件则是用来存储这些表的结构和数据的二进制文件。
pck文件可以包含一个或多个表的数据。它通常包含表的元数据信息,例如表名、列名、数据类型等。此外,pck文件还可以包含索引信息,用于提高数据的查询效率。索引可以根据某一列或多个列的值来进行排序和搜索,从而加快数据的检索速度。
数据库pck文件的优点是可以高效地存储和管理大量的数据。由于pck文件是二进制文件,所以它的存储空间效率比文本文件要高。此外,pck文件还支持数据的压缩和加密,可以保护数据的安全性。
使用pck文件可以方便地备份和恢复数据库。通过备份pck文件,可以将数据库的结构和数据保存到一个文件中,以防止数据丢失。而通过恢复pck文件,可以将备份的数据重新导入到数据库中,从而恢复数据库的状态。
总之,数据库pck文件是一种用于存储和管理数据库中数据的二进制文件格式,它包含了表的结构、数据记录、索引等信息,可以高效地存储和管理大量的数据,并提供了备份和恢复数据库的功能。
1年前 -
数据库pck文件是一种数据库备份文件,用于将数据库的结构和数据保存为一个单独的文件。PCK文件是数据库备份的一种常见格式,可以在需要的时候用于还原数据库。
PCK文件通常包含以下内容:
- 数据库的结构:包括表、字段、索引、触发器等数据库对象的定义。
- 数据库的数据:包括表中的所有记录。
下面是使用不同数据库管理系统的方法和操作流程来生成和使用PCK文件的详细说明。
一、MySQL数据库
-
生成PCK文件
- 使用命令行工具:可以使用mysqldump命令来生成PCK文件,命令格式如下:
mysqldump -u username -p password database_name > backup.pck其中,username是数据库用户名,password是用户密码,database_name是要备份的数据库名,backup.pck是生成的备份文件名。
- 使用图形化工具:可以使用MySQL Workbench等图形化工具来生成PCK文件,具体操作步骤如下:
- 打开MySQL Workbench,连接到目标数据库。
- 在导航栏中选择“Server”->“Data Export”。
- 选择要备份的数据库和数据表。
- 选择备份文件格式为PCK,并指定保存路径。
- 点击“Start Export”开始生成备份文件。
- 使用命令行工具:可以使用mysqldump命令来生成PCK文件,命令格式如下:
还原PCK文件
- 使用命令行工具:可以使用mysql命令来还原PCK文件,命令格式如下:
mysql -u username -p password database_name < backup.pck其中,username是数据库用户名,password是用户密码,database_name是要还原的数据库名,backup.pck是要还原的备份文件名。
- 使用图形化工具:可以使用MySQL Workbench等图形化工具来还原PCK文件,具体操作步骤如下:
- 打开MySQL Workbench,连接到目标数据库。
- 在导航栏中选择“Server”->“Data Import”。
- 选择要还原的数据库和数据表。
- 选择备份文件格式为PCK,并指定备份文件路径。
- 点击“Start Import”开始还原备份文件。
- 使用命令行工具:可以使用mysql命令来还原PCK文件,命令格式如下:
二、Oracle数据库
-
生成PCK文件
- 使用命令行工具:可以使用expdp命令来生成PCK文件,命令格式如下:
expdp username/password@database_name dumpfile=backup.pck其中,username是数据库用户名,password是用户密码,database_name是要备份的数据库名,backup.pck是生成的备份文件名。
- 使用图形化工具:可以使用Oracle SQL Developer等图形化工具来生成PCK文件,具体操作步骤如下:
- 打开Oracle SQL Developer,连接到目标数据库。
- 在导航栏中选择“Tools”->“Database Export”。
- 选择要备份的数据库对象。
- 选择备份文件格式为PCK,并指定保存路径。
- 点击“Finish”开始生成备份文件。
- 使用命令行工具:可以使用expdp命令来生成PCK文件,命令格式如下:
还原PCK文件
- 使用命令行工具:可以使用impdp命令来还原PCK文件,命令格式如下:
impdp username/password@database_name dumpfile=backup.pck其中,username是数据库用户名,password是用户密码,database_name是要还原的数据库名,backup.pck是要还原的备份文件名。
- 使用图形化工具:可以使用Oracle SQL Developer等图形化工具来还原PCK文件,具体操作步骤如下:
- 打开Oracle SQL Developer,连接到目标数据库。
- 在导航栏中选择“Tools”->“Database Import”。
- 选择要还原的数据库对象。
- 选择备份文件格式为PCK,并指定备份文件路径。
- 点击“Next”开始还原备份文件。
- 使用命令行工具:可以使用impdp命令来还原PCK文件,命令格式如下:
三、SQL Server数据库
-
生成PCK文件
- 使用命令行工具:可以使用sqlcmd命令来生成PCK文件,命令格式如下:
sqlcmd -S server_name -U username -P password -Q "BACKUP DATABASE database_name TO DISK='C:\backup.pck'"其中,server_name是数据库服务器名称,username是数据库用户名,password是用户密码,database_name是要备份的数据库名,C:\backup.pck是生成的备份文件路径。
- 使用图形化工具:可以使用SQL Server Management Studio等图形化工具来生成PCK文件,具体操作步骤如下:
- 打开SQL Server Management Studio,连接到目标数据库服务器。
- 在对象资源管理器中选择要备份的数据库。
- 右键点击数据库,选择“任务”->“备份”。
- 选择备份类型为“完整”,并指定备份文件路径。
- 点击“确定”开始生成备份文件。
- 使用命令行工具:可以使用sqlcmd命令来生成PCK文件,命令格式如下:
还原PCK文件
- 使用命令行工具:可以使用sqlcmd命令来还原PCK文件,命令格式如下:
sqlcmd -S server_name -U username -P password -Q "RESTORE DATABASE database_name FROM DISK='C:\backup.pck'"其中,server_name是数据库服务器名称,username是数据库用户名,password是用户密码,database_name是要还原的数据库名,C:\backup.pck是要还原的备份文件路径。
- 使用图形化工具:可以使用SQL Server Management Studio等图形化工具来还原PCK文件,具体操作步骤如下:
- 打开SQL Server Management Studio,连接到目标数据库服务器。
- 在对象资源管理器中选择要还原的数据库。
- 右键点击数据库,选择“任务”->“还原”->“数据库”。
- 在“源”选项卡中选择备份文件路径。
- 点击“确定”开始还原备份文件。
- 使用命令行工具:可以使用sqlcmd命令来还原PCK文件,命令格式如下:
四、其他数据库
对于其他数据库管理系统,生成和还原PCK文件的方法和操作流程可能会有所不同。可以参考对应数据库管理系统的官方文档或手册,寻找生成和还原PCK文件的具体方法和操作步骤。一般来说,这些数据库管理系统都提供了命令行工具或图形化工具来进行备份和还原操作。1年前